2017-07-03 45 views
-2

我在要求用戶輸入自己的名字和密碼如何驗證我的用戶登錄信息

<html> 
<body> 

<formaction="welcome.php"method="post"> 
Name: <inputtype="text"name="name"><br> 
Password: <inputtype="text"name="pass. word"><br> 
<input type="create"> 
</form> 

</body> 
</html> 

,並從代碼的HTML表單上方你會看到我看到一個PHP頁面,該信息是發送到(表單處理程序/表單處理)

現在我創建了登錄另一個頁面中的帳戶創建

<html> 
<body> 

<form> 
Name: <inputtype="text"name="name"><br> 
    Password: <inputtype="text"name="password"><br> 
<input type="Login"> 
</form> 

</body> 
</html> 

我想知道的登錄頁面去檢查WEL來的頁面(表格處理程序/表格處理器),其中註冊的信息被髮送到,要知道如果帳戶/用戶存在是否打開到homepage.html,但如果沒有重置頁面

但我不知道在哪裏從這裏走,有人請幫我

+2

在[所以]你應該嘗試**自己寫代碼**。後** [做更多的研究](//meta.stackoverflow.com/questions/261592)**如果你有問題,你可以**發佈你已經嘗試**與清楚的解釋是什麼是'工作**並提供[** Minimal,Complete和Verifiable示例**](// stackoverflow.com/help/mcve)。我建議閱讀[問]一個好問題和[完美問題](http://codeblog.jonskeet.uk/2010/08/29/writing-the-perfect-question/)。另外,一定要參加[遊覽]並閱讀[this](// meta.stackoverflow.com/questions/347937/)**。 –

+0

注意''inputtype =「text」name =「name」>'WRONG'好得多 – RiggsFolly

回答

-1

使用PHP,你需要實現會話。

在兩個PHP文件的頂部試試這個:

<?php 
session_start(); 

然後,一旦你驗證了該用戶具有權限的登錄,你可以做這樣的事情。

$_SESSION['loggedin'] = true; 

然後,您可以從任何啓用會話的文件訪問該會話變量。

+0

我在遇到問題時試圖檢查在「如果提供的信息是之前創建的任何賬戶的正確信息,則用戶登錄「表單有效/ – Britchi

+0

有兩種方法可以檢查它。提交表單後,您可以在前端使用javascript或在後端使用PHP。 你將不得不澄清你已經完成和測試了什麼,以及在任何人可以幫助你之前得到的錯誤。 – Difster